- The distance between Stratford Dem Farm, New Zealand and Bourke, New South Wales, Australia is approximately 2,776 km or 1,725 mi.
- To reach Stratford Dem Farm in this distance one would set out from Bourke, New South Wales bearing 119.5° or ESE and follow the great circles arc to approach Stratford Dem Farm bearing 103.1° or ESE .
- Stratford Dem Farm has a marine west coast climate (Cfb) whereas Bourke, New South Wales has a subtropical hot steppe climate (BSh).
- Stratford Dem Farm is in or near the warm temperate thorn steppe biome whereas Bourke, New South Wales is in or near the subtropical thorn woodland biome.
- The average temperature is 8.4 °C (15.2°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 7.6 °C (13.7°F) less in Stratford Dem Farm. The continentality subtype is barely hyperoceanic as opposed to truly oce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1667.6 mm (65.7 in) more which is equivalent to 1667.6 l/m² (40.93 US gal/ft²) or 16,676,000 l/ha (1,782,775 US gal/ac) more. About 5 1/2 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 9.2° lower in Stratford Dem Farm than in Bourke, New South Wales.
